Job Description

Director of Product Management overseeing AI detection strategies and protections at Cisco. Leading cross-functional initiatives in cybersecurity and threat intelligence for advanced security solutions.

Responsibilities:

  • Define and Drive AI Detection Strategy
  • Develop and execute a multi-product strategy for AI-powered threat detections and protections
  • Scale Talos' proprietary AI and machine learning capabilities to stay ahead of sophisticated cyber threats and nation-state adversaries
  • Identify emerging threat trends and translate them into detection and protection capabilities across Cisco's security portfolio
  • Own the Product Lifecycle
  • Lead the end-to-end lifecycle of AI and ML detection engines and protection services
  • Define and measure success through coverage, efficacy, performance, adoption, and customer outcomes
  • Drive continuous innovation while balancing operational excellence and scalability
  • Drive Portfolio Integration
  • Lead the integration of Talos AI detections and protections across Cisco Security products and platforms
  • Create a unified intelligence-first customer experience across network, cloud, endpoint, identity, and AI security solutions
  • Partner across engineering, data science, product, and security teams to define common data models, telemetry requirements, and detection frameworks
  • Collaborate with ecosystem partners, SIEM, SOAR, and Cisco Cloud control and Security control platforms to maximize customer value
  • Lead Through Influence
  • Align stakeholders around strategic priorities, technical direction, and business outcomes and drive cross-functional execution across globally distributed teams
  • Establish Responsible AI Practices
  • Define standards for ethical, transparent, and resilient AI security solutions to ensure AI detection models are unbiased, explainable, secure, and resistant to adversarial attacks
  • Align products with global privacy, compliance, and data sovereignty requirements

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ree and 12+ years of experience, or Masters and 8+ years of experience, or PhD and 6+ years of experience to include 4+ years of direct or indirect people leadership
  • 5+ years of leadership experience in enterprise cybersecurity offerings to include threat intelligence or security centric AI/ML-based products
  • Experience building and scaling security platforms, detection technologies, or threat intelligence solutions
  • Experience driving large, cross-functional initiatives across engineering, data science, and business teams
  • Experience with threat intelligence, detection engineering, or security operations (Preferred)
  • Experience leading multi-product or platform-level strategies (Preferred)
  • Familiarity with GenAI, Agentic AI, LLM security, and AI governance frameworks (Preferred)
  • Strong communication and executive presentation skills (Preferred)
